WebBoston Fern temperature tolerance. Listed as being hardy in Zone 10 – 12, the Boston Fern (Nephrolepis exaltata) prefers to grow in temperatures between 65° to 75° … WebWater Boston fern as the potting mix starts to dry. In especially hot or windy weather, that may mean daily waterings. In cool weather, Boston fern uses less moisture and doesn't need watering as often. If it dries out too much, the fronds turn brown and crispy. Outdoors, Boston ferns are winter hardy in Zones 10-12. Get more tips for buying ... WebBoston Fern temperature tolerance. Listed as being hardy in Zone 10 – 12, the Boston Fern (Nephrolepis exaltata) prefers to grow in temperatures between 65° to 75° Fahrenheit (18° to 24° Celsius). Daytime temperatures of 75° Fahrenheit that gradually drop to 65° Fahrenheit during the night are ideal for the Boston Fern. arani 7toun mp3

WebNov 11, 2012 · How to fertilize a Boston fern: Feed monthly when the plant is actively growing with a balanced, liquid fertilizer. Dilute the plant food 1/4 to 1/2 the recommended strength to prevent the ends of the fronds from turning brown due to fertilizer burn. Temperature. Best temperature for a Boston fern: Temperature should be 60°-70°F … WebMay 26, 2024 · Temperature. Boston Ferns prefer standard house temperatures between 60 and 70 degrees Fahrenheit. However, they are tolerant of slightly colder temperatures (around 50 degrees Fahrenheit). But don’t let it fall lower than that, or you’ll start to see problems. Humidity.
